AJ Styles will face Samoa Joe at Hell in a Cell PPV for the WWE Championship. The dream rivalry between these two veteran superstars started at Summerslam PPV. We did not get a proper outcome of the match, as it ended in a disqualified manner. It was just a beginning of the feud on Smackdown. So a rematch was evident to happen.
Just days later, WWE confirmed Samoa Joe would get his rematch against AJ Styles. It will take place at the Hell in a Cell PPV. The previous thinking was they might compete inside the steel structure in a completely different environment.
But now they will lock horns in a one-on-one singles contest. Meanwhile, we might have received a spoiler of this match.
Before coming to the point, we want to let you know AJ Styles will have to take on Samoa Joe one more time on October 6th. WWE is heading to Australia for the biggest live event in the history of the company. Some of the marquee matches are already official for this night. One of them is the WWE Championship match between these two Smackdown superstars.
